Here's what I came up with. The quilt top measures 46 x 68--a nice size. It called for one more row--but I thought that would make it too long. It didn't need that row to complete the design--it kind of made it incomplete. I added it on the Sunflower one, but thought then it was a tad long. I'll add the Sunflower picture too.

Edited to add: The strips in the Sunflower one follow the directions- 1.75 in strips-with 6.75 in squares. The Sunny Day strips are 1.5 and the squares are 5.5. I like the smaller size better. :-)
